Andreas Petersen (guldberg)

Andreas worked on the lazyvim/lazyvim repository, focusing on maintaining plugin compatibility within the Lua-based LazyVim ecosystem. He addressed a critical maintenance issue by updating the CopilotChat.nvim branch reference from canary to main, ensuring that users continued to access the latest Copilot features without disruption. This fix required careful attention to version control and plugin development practices, as it preserved workflow stability for downstream users relying on Copilot integration. While the scope of work was limited to a single bug fix over one month, Andreas demonstrated a solid understanding of Lua scripting and the intricacies of plugin management in collaborative environments.
